  1. Very Old Fudge

    6 servings

    2 cup White (granulated) sugar
    1/2 cup Corn syrup
    2/2 cup Milk or cream 1 tsp Butter 1 tsp Pure Vanilla Extract Optional: 1/2 cup nuts Optional:
    candied cherries

    Mix the first four ingredients, stirring occasionally. Boil to soft to medium ball stage. Use a
    candy thermometer. Cook, add vanilla and beat with a wooden spoon until stiff. Add nuts and candied
    cherries if desired.

    Variation: For chocolate fudge, add 2 Tbsp cocoa.
